CUSD Summer School Options
CUSD is planning a Summer Elementary Learning Recovery Program for students who may need additional instruction in Math and Foundational Reading. The 3-hour program will run daily from July 6-21. It will be housed at eleven of our schools across the district. An additional component of the program will include Hands-On Science learning.Invitations to attend the program will be going out soon to those students who would benefit from the three week program. There is no cost to families for students invited to the program.

Additionally, Saddleback Community Education will again be providing fee-based summer school camps and classes for families. Camp Invention, Emerald Cove Day Camp, and Camp Galileo all offer students opportunities to engage in invention, innovation, and creativity.
Saddleback Community Education also offers week-long classes at various CUSD sites providing a “jump start” for students to help get ready for the Fall. At the Middle School level, students have access to the Middle School Summer Academy. There will be two summer sessions offered to all current 6th through 8th grade students. The program is a 3 week program with one session offered in June and the other in July. The focus is on reinforcing essential skills with excellent lessons in both math and English, as well as reinforcing priority concepts in science and social studies. At the High School level, Summer School will be offered on all six of our traditional high school campuses. Students can conveniently attend their home school and remediate up to 10 credits. Students have the option to enroll in online courses or in-person instruction. Classes will be offered at all grade levels covering subjects such as English, Math, Science with labs, Language,
Electives, English Language Support, Math Support, Geometry for acceleration, and Health. Students should check with their Academic Advisor to see what is available at their site and what they might qualify to attend.
